Woody Allen Quotes
Brief author info: Woody Allen (1935- ) American actor, film director, writer.
Showing: 1 - 10 Woody Allen Quotes of 78
I'm not afraid of death; I just don't want to be there when it happens.
Showing up is eighty percent of life.
I'm not afraid of death; I just don't want to be there when it happens.
Sex alleviates tension. Love causes it.
The heart wants what the heart wants.
I can't even make a leap of faith to believe in my own existence.
Eighty per cent of success is showing up.
To you I'm an atheist. To God I'm the loyal opposition.
She wore a short skirt and a tight sweater and her figure described a set of parabolas that would cause cardiac arrest in a yak.
